Output d8fc08c8a2d60a31ac33351cec350f7284765282fea8cac239dd1f9fe1568cc5:2

value
43868480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ae69ae81fd0bb17218a64d91595a61d77c72d559 OP_EQUAL
address
MPoNQhYkN1yqkDdyujRTDqauBs7nkihEyB
transaction
d8fc08c8a2d60a31ac33351cec350f7284765282fea8cac239dd1f9fe1568cc5
spent
true